2.MD.C.8 Lesson Plans

CCSS.MATH.CONTENT.2.MD.C.8

:
"Solve word problems involving dollar bills, quarters, dimes, nickels, and pennies, using $ and ¢ symbols appropriately."

Our Take:Students solve money problems that involve whole dollar amounts and coins (quarters, dimes, nickels, and pennies) and they know how to use the $ and ¢ symbols. Prior to solving problems that involve dollars and cents, students must first be able to recognize and know the values of the various bills and coins. Matching worksheets that require students to draw a line from a coin to its value help reinforce knowledge of coin recognition.

These lesson plans can help students practice this Common Core State Standards skill.
